Méthode IAudioStreamVolume ::GetChannelCount (audioclient.h)
La méthode GetChannelCount récupère le nombre de canaux dans le flux audio.
Syntaxe
HRESULT GetChannelCount(
[out] UINT32 *pdwCount
);
Paramètres
[out] pdwCount
Pointeur vers une variable UINT32 dans laquelle la méthode écrit le nombre de canaux.
Valeur retournée
Si la méthode réussit, retourne S_OK. En cas d’échec, les codes de retour possibles incluent, sans s’y limiter, les valeurs indiquées dans le tableau suivant.
Code de retour | Description |
---|---|
|
Le paramètre pdwCount a la valeur NULL. |
|
Le périphérique de point de terminaison audio a été débranché, ou le matériel audio ou les ressources matérielles associées ont été reconfigurés, désactivés, supprimés ou autrement indisponibles. |
|
Le service audio Windows n’est pas en cours d’exécution. |
Remarques
Appelez cette méthode pour obtenir le nombre de canaux dans le flux audio avant d’appeler l’une des autres méthodes de l’interface IAudioStreamVolume .
Configuration requise
Condition requise | Valeur |
---|---|
Client minimal pris en charge | Windows Vista [applications de bureau uniquement] |
Serveur minimal pris en charge | Windows Server 2008 [applications de bureau uniquement] |
Plateforme cible | Windows |
En-tête | audioclient.h |